Yesterday we had planned to go the Women, Infants and Children(WIC) office before we realized that the office was quite far from home and couldnt be reached simply by walking, which the only thing possible for us currently. FYI, The WIC is providing foods coupons for infants and children from the low income families so that every child gets proper nourishment. Since abah is not working, and ibu is a student, we are considered as a low income family and basically eligible to enroll in the program.
However, we'd to postpone our registration until we can find a transportation. The kids must come to the WIC office for the registration.
